In a significant development this week, the artificial intelligence landscape has been rocked by a high-stakes standoff between two of the industry's most influential giants: OpenAI and Apple. The controversy, which has dominated tech headlines in recent days, centers on allegations that OpenAI may have improperly accessed or utilized proprietary trade secrets. In a move that signals a shift toward radical transparency in corporate defense, OpenAI has broken its silence, explicitly stating that Apple's legal narrative is built upon fundamental misunderstandings. By choosing to publish internal chat logs and documentation, OpenAI is not merely defending its reputation; it is setting a new precedent for how AI firms navigate intellectual property disputes in an era where data lineage and model training ethics are under intense global scrutiny from regulators and competitors alike.
The decision to air internal communications is a calculated strategic maneuver. In the legal world, silence is often interpreted as an admission of guilt, but in the fast-paced world of technology, silence can be fatal to investor confidence. OpenAI’s decision to publish these records stems from a desire to neutralize the narrative before it gains further traction in the courtroom. By providing context to their internal development cycles, the company is attempting to demonstrate a clear 'paper trail' that confirms their AI models—such as GPT-4o—were built using massive, ethically curated datasets rather than poached corporate secrets. This transparency serves as a shield against the 'black box' criticism often leveled at generative AI developers. At the center of this controversy is the accusation that OpenAI improperly leveraged Apple's proprietary infrastructure or trade secrets during the rapid scaling of its latest models. OpenAI has consistently refuted these claims, pointing to a lack of evidence in the initial filings. The company argues that the accusations represent a misunderstanding of how neural networks are architected and trained. In recent filings, OpenAI clarified that the internal chat logs demonstrate a collaborative, research-driven environment focused on open-source principles and independent innovation, rather than the clandestine acquisition of competitor data. This dispute highlights the 'gray area' in intellectual property law as it applies to AI. When a model 'learns' from public internet data that happens to contain proprietary information, where does the liability lie? OpenAI's defense suggests that they are taking a proactive stance to define these boundaries, pushing for a legal standard that separates 'learning from the ecosystem' from 'stealing proprietary trade secrets.'

Industry analysts have largely viewed OpenAI's transparency move as a 'masterclass in PR defense.' By releasing internal chat logs, OpenAI is forcing the public and the courts to engage with the actual data rather than speculative headlines. This approach shifts the burden of proof back onto the accuser. However, some legal experts caution that this level of transparency is a double-edged sword. While it may exonerate them of specific trade secret allegations, it also provides competitors with a rare glimpse into the internal culture and decision-making processes of the organization. For a company like OpenAI, which prides itself on its research-first ethos, this is a calculated risk. The consensus among tech observers is that we are witnessing the beginning of a new era of 'open-book' AI development, where companies will be expected to provide more visibility into their internal workflows to maintain their license to operate in a sensitive global market.
